Third consecutive draw for Arsenal in the Premier League, where they were stopped at 3-3 by bottom-of-the-table Southampton ahead of matchday 32.
The team coached by the Spaniard Mikel Arteta now has an advantage of just 5 points over the very active Manchester City (second), which however has to recover two games.
Now he will face the Gunners, in a challenge that could be worth the title.
Only a victory at the Etihad would allow the Londoners to regain the upper hand, but in their current form it looks very difficult, as the Citizens have won 25 points out of the last 27 available.
